Yara International Opens Europe's Largest Green Hydrogen Plant

The facility aims to cut CO2 emissions by 5% at one of Norway's largest industrial sites, advancing decarbonization efforts in the fertilizer industry.

  • Yara International ASA inaugurated a 24-megawatt renewable hydrogen plant in Norway.
  • The plant will reduce annual CO2 emissions by 5% at the Heroya factory, a major industrial emitter.
  • Green ammonia produced from this plant is seen as a key solution for decarbonizing shipping, power generation, and agriculture.
  • Further expansion of green hydrogen capacity is contingent on a complete conversion of the entire ammonia plant.
  • Yara is also exploring blue ammonia projects and carbon capture initiatives in the Netherlands and the US.
